第一部分:认识AR技术
在夜晚的宁静中,想象一下自己正站在AR技术的门槛上,准备开启一段全新的旅程。增强现实(Augmented Reality,简称AR)技术,顾名思义,是在现实世界中叠加虚拟信息的技术。它不仅改变了游戏和娱乐领域,还在教育、医疗、建筑等多个行业发挥着重要作用。
什么是AR技术?
AR技术通过摄像头捕捉现实世界的图像,然后通过计算机处理,将这些图像与虚拟物体叠加,从而创造出一种新的现实体验。这种技术使得虚拟世界与现实世界无缝融合,为用户带来更加丰富和沉浸式的体验。
AR技术的应用领域
- 游戏与娱乐:如《精灵宝可梦GO》等游戏,让玩家在现实世界中捕捉虚拟精灵。
- 教育与培训:通过AR技术,学生可以更加直观地学习复杂的概念,如人体解剖学、历史场景重现等。
- 医疗:医生可以利用AR技术进行手术模拟,提高手术成功率。
- 建筑与设计:在建筑设计阶段,AR技术可以帮助设计师更直观地展示设计方案。
第二部分:实战技巧
1. 学习基础知识
在夜晚的灯光下,开始你的学习之旅。首先,你需要掌握以下基础知识:
- 计算机视觉:学习如何使用摄像头捕捉现实世界的图像。
- 图形学:了解如何创建和渲染虚拟物体。
- 编程语言:学习C++、Java或Python等编程语言,它们是AR开发的主要工具。
2. 使用AR开发平台
选择一个适合自己的AR开发平台,如Unity、ARKit或ARCore。这些平台提供了丰富的API和工具,可以帮助你更快地开发AR应用。
3. 实践项目
理论知识固然重要,但实践才是检验真理的唯一标准。尝试以下项目:
- 制作一个简单的AR游戏:例如,创建一个AR版本的“猜猜我是谁”游戏。
- 开发一个AR教育应用:将一个复杂的概念通过AR技术呈现出来。
4. 学习社区与资源
加入AR技术社区,如Stack Overflow、GitHub等,与其他开发者交流心得。同时,利用在线资源,如教程、博客和视频,不断提升自己的技能。
第三部分:学习路径
1. 初级阶段
- 学习计算机视觉和图形学基础知识。
- 掌握至少一种编程语言。
- 使用AR开发平台进行简单项目实践。
2. 中级阶段
- 深入学习AR技术原理。
- 学习使用高级AR开发工具和API。
- 参与实际项目,提升解决问题的能力。
3. 高级阶段
- 参与AR技术研究和开发。
- 探索AR技术在各个领域的应用。
- 成为AR技术领域的专家。
总结
夜晚的宁静中,你心中的梦想正在悄然生长。通过学习AR技术,你可以将现实世界与虚拟世界相结合,创造出令人惊叹的体验。记住,成功并非一蹴而就,但只要坚持不懈,你终将成为一位AR技术达人。祝你在AR技术的道路上越走越远!
